Job Description
This full-time 12-month position reports to the Dean of Health Sciences and fulfills the primary role of administrative support for the division. The Administrative Assistant for Health Sciences provides comprehensive administrative and clerical support to the Health Sciences department at Wilkes Community College. This position supports faculty, staff, and program leadership by coordinating daily office operations, maintaining records, assisting with scheduling and communication, and supporting departmental processes. The Administrative Assistant plays a key role in promoting efficient operations and effective communication within the Health Sciences division.

Essential Duties Summary
Core duties will include the following:
Academic Support
Academic Support
- Provide comprehensive administrative support to the Dean, department chairs, and full-time and part-time/adjunct faculty within the Health Sciences division.
- Develop and distribute instructor schedules each semester and submit final schedules to the Vice President of Instruction’s office.
- Coordinate completion and submission of textbook orders to ensure compliance with established deadlines.
- Collect, maintain, and archive course syllabi in accordance with divisional and institutional requirements.
- Assist faculty with census, attendance, and final grade rosters; monitor reports to ensure timely and accurate submission.
Budget and Fiscal Support
- Research vendors, compare pricing, and prepare purchase requisitions in accordance with college purchasing procedures.
- Monitor, order, and maintain office supplies for the Health Sciences division.
- Assist the Dean with budget documentation, tracking, and reporting; submit fiscal paperwork to the business office in a timely manner.
- Process travel requests and reimbursement documentation for faculty and staff.
- Develop and maintain adjunct faculty contracts and related documentation.
Accreditation and Compliance Support
- Maintain departmental records to support accreditation, program reviews, audits, and compliance with institutional and NCCCS requirements.
- Assist in organizing and compiling documentation required for accreditation visits, reports, and ongoing compliance activities.
Facilities and Operational Support
- Coordinate daily office operations to ensure efficient and effective functioning of the Health Sciences division.
- Oversee working conditions of office equipment and conduct regular inventory of departmental equipment.
- Provide facilities operational support to the Dean, including coordinating maintenance requests, space utilization needs, equipment issues, and communication with facilities staff to support instructional and administrative operations.
- Receive and professionally respond to incoming calls, visitors, and inquiries, providing high-quality customer service.
- Support division-sponsored meetings, workshops, and special academic events.
Professional and Institutional Responsibilities
- Serve on college committees and task forces as assigned.
- Participate in professional development opportunities, both internal and external.
- Demonstrate commitment to the mission, vision, and core values of Wilkes Community College and the North Carolina Community College System.
- Perform other related duties as assigned by the supervisor.
